All circulation 1983 quarters should have a P or D next to the bow in Washington's wig.
If your coin is missing the the mint mark it could be due to a filled die or general wear. Use a strong magnifying glass to see if there's still a trace of it. If so, it's probably not worth much more than face value. If there's absolutely no mint mark visible, you should have it inspected in person.
1983 quarters are difficult to find in decent shape because the Mint was trying to correct deficiencies with the denomination's dies. Unfortunately their first efforts fell quite short.
